are a finance intern at Chambers and Sons and they have asked you to help estimate the company's cost of common equity You obtained the following data: D1 = $1.25; P0 = $27.50; g = 5.00% (constant) ; and F = 6.00% What is the cost of equity raised by selling new common stock?
